Directions to Solve
Look carefully for the pattern, and then choose which pair of numbers comes next.
2.
8 11 21 15 18 21 22
Answer: Option
Explanation:
This is an alternating addition series, with a random number, 21, interpolated as every third number. The addition series alternates between adding 3 and adding 4. The number 21 appears after each number arrived at by adding 3.

8 11 [21] 15 18 [21] 22 25 [21] 29 32 [21] 36 39 [21] 43 46 [21] ....
Here 3, 4 is added alternatively and [21] injected as given below:
Inital = 8
8 + 3 = 11
********** [21]
11 + 4 = 15
15 + 3 = 18
********** [21]
18 + 4 = 22
22 + 3 = 25 <----- Required Answer
********** [21] <----- Required Answer
25 + 4 = 29
29 + 3 = 32
.........etc
